Definitions and Meaning of delegate in English

Wordnet

delegate (n)

a person appointed or elected to represent others

Wordnet

delegate (v)

transfer power to someone

give an assignment to (a person) to a post, or assign a task to (a person)

Webster

delegate (n.)

Any one sent and empowered to act for another; one deputed to represent; a chosen deputy; a representative; a commissioner; a vicar.

One elected by the people of a territory to represent them in Congress, where he has the right of debating, but not of voting.

One sent by any constituency to act as its representative in a convention; as, a delegate to a convention for nominating officers, or for forming or altering a constitution.

Webster

delegate (a.)

Sent to act for or represent another; deputed; as, a delegate judge.

Webster

delegate (v. t.)

To send as one's representative; to empower as an ambassador; to send with power to transact business; to commission; to depute; to authorize.

To intrust to the care or management of another; to transfer; to assign; to commit.
